KEYPAD
•
HOME
– Takes you to the Run Status screen,
from which you can access all the sub-screens.
•
CANCEL
– Cancels an entry and turns off
“Edit”
mode
•
ENTER
– Key is used to select sub menus,
enter the “
Edit
” mode in the
“Setpoints”
menu,
and change and accept values in the
“Setpoints”
menu. The ENTER key will only work with
items contained within [ ].
•
INC
– Key is used in the changed mode to toggle
a value ON or OFF or to increase a numerical
value.
•
DEC
– Key is used in the changed mode to toggle
a value ON or OFF or to decrease a numerical
value.
•
< (Left Arrow)
– Key is used to scroll backward
through a list of options.
•
> (Right Arrow)
– Key is used to scroll forward
through a list of options
•
ALARM
– The LED will be energized any time
an Alarm is active.

Run Status
Off - Normal
This screen is present at power up and is the default
screen. After ten minutes of inactivity, the display will
revert to this screen.
RUN STATUS SCREEN
•
Off – Normal
– The screen will display this mode
of operation when:
−
The “On / Auto / Off” toggle switch is in the
OFF position
−
When the internal schedule is in the STOP
(off) time
−
When
“Unit Enable”
is turned off through the
keypad or by a communicated command.
•
Starting
– The screen will display this mode
of operation as the unit transitions between the
Off-Normal and On-Normal mode. When the air
proving switch circuit closes, the unit will switch
from Starting to On-Normal.
